Taxonomical Classification

This plant belongs to the kingdom Plantae and is classified under the phylum Streptophyta within the class Equisetopsida. It falls under the subclass Magnoliidae and the order Malvales, eventually reaching its taxonomic placement in the family Malvaceae. Finally, it is identified by its specific genus, Cola.

Distribution

This plant, Cola cordifolia, exhibits a specific distribution pattern throughout the West Tropical Africa region. Its presence is documented across several distinct nations, starting with Burkina. It can also be found within the territories of Gambia and Guinea-Bissau. Furthermore, the species extends its range into the country of Guinea. Finally, its geographical reach includes the coastal landscapes of the Ivory Coast.

Morphology

The morphology of Cola cordifolia is characterized by its stature as a large tree, reaching a mean height of 15 m and a maximum height of approximately 15.24 m. It exhibits a woody structure and functions as a self-supporting climber, categorized as both a self-supporting climber and a self-supporting plant type. The species is terrestrial in nature, rather than aquatic or epiphytic, and grows as an independent organism without parasitic tendencies.

Reproduction

The reproduction of Cola cordifolia is characterized by the development of fruit that can range in texture from fleshy to dry. Within these fruits, the seeds play a critical role in the propagation of the species, exhibiting a highly consistent size profile. Specifically, the seed volume is remarkably uniform, with a minimum, maximum, and mean volume all measured at exactly 7800 mm³.
